SQS-242 Operating Manual

The communications parameters (baud, parity, bits, stop) are shown below the
Comm Port dropdown. The baud rate can be changed in the SQS242.INI file (see

section 3.8

).

Address: Several PLCs can be controlled from a single computer Comm Port by
connecting their expansion ports. The slave address of each such PLC is usually
set by a rotary or dip switch, and must be unique. Single PLC systems usually use
Address 0. Consult your PLC User Manual.

If the PLC is found at the selected Comm Port and Address, the COMM LED on
the PLC will flash continuously. The PLC model is displayed below the address.

3.5.4.6 Card Tab

Figure 3-23 Card tab

Mode: In Normal mode, the SQS-242 gets readings from the SQM-242 card(s). In
Simulate mode, the SQS-242 generates simulated readings even if a card is not
installed. This is useful for testing new processes and learning the software.

The firmware revisions of the installed SQM-242 cards are listed below the mode
buttons. A value of 0 indicates the card is not installed. Analog Rev refers to the
revision of an SAM-242,card if installed. DLL Return is the status of the SQM-242
card’s Windows drivers. DLL return values of 9XX indicate a card installation error.

Front Panel Enabled: When used with the SRC series computer, enables/disables
the SQS-242 software to read the SoftKeys.

Period: Sets the measurement period between 0.2 seconds (5 readings per
second) and 2 seconds. A longer period gives higher reading accuracy, especially
at low rates.
